Etymology[edit]

From Ancient Greek πρίστις (prístis, sawfish), from πρῐ́ζω (prízō) / πρίω (príō, to saw) + -τις (-tis, nominal suffix).

Proper noun[edit]

Pristis f or m

  1. A taxonomic genus within the family Pristidae – most species of sawfish.
